This Halloween Lottery Ad Features a Screaming Couple

The 'Halloween Superdraw: Scream' lottery ad from Gold Lotto puts a clever spin on reasons why someone might scream their lungs out while looking at a TV screen. Initially, it seems that a woman is watching something terrifying on TV, but when her spouse joins in, becomes clear that the pair is actually celebrating over a winning lottery ticket.

The ad for the $20 Million Halloween Superdraw is a fun way to show that not all of the things that might make you scream around this time of year are necessarily scary.

In order to help people put themselves in the shoes of a lottery winner, this ad is a funny reflection of how anyone might react to finding they've suddenly become a multi-millionaire in a matter of a few moments.
